The Rise of Sovereign AI Infrastructure

For the past several years, the AI gold rush was dominated by a handful of hyperscalers providing cloud compute. However, a critical trend has emerged: Sovereign AI. Nations are increasingly viewing AI capabilities as a matter of national security and economic autonomy, leading to a surge in government-funded data centers that operate independently of traditional US-based cloud providers.

This shift expands the total addressable market for hardware providers. The demand is no longer limited to the capital expenditure budgets of a few tech giants but is now distributed across national budgets. Companies that provide the silicon, the networking fabric, and the cooling systems necessary for these massive installations are positioned as the foundational layer of the intelligence economy. The key to longevity in this sector is the move toward energy-efficient compute, as power constraints have become the primary bottleneck for scaling AI clusters globally.

From Chatbots to the Agentic Economy

While the previous phase of AI was defined by generative interfaces—chatbots that could write emails or summarize documents—the current focus is on "Agentic AI." This represents a transition from passive tools to autonomous agents capable of executing complex, multi-step workflows with minimal human intervention.

Investment value is migrating toward platforms that possess the "orchestration layer." The most valuable companies in this space are those that integrate AI agents directly into existing enterprise workflows. By automating not just the creation of content, but the execution of business processes (such as supply chain management or automated financial auditing), these companies are transforming AI from a productivity aid into a labor-replacement technology. The moat for these firms is no longer the model itself—as models are becoming commoditized—but the proprietary data and deep integration into the client's operational architecture.

The Edge AI Frontier and Hardware Decentralization

As cloud costs rise and latency remains a hurdle for real-time applications, the industry is witnessing a massive migration toward Edge AI. This involves moving the inference process from centralized data centers directly onto the end-user's device—smartphones, laptops, and IoT sensors.

This transition is sparking a hardware refresh cycle of unprecedented scale. Consumers are upgrading devices not for better cameras or screens, but for integrated Neural Processing Units (NPUs) capable of running local Large Language Models (LLMs). This decentralization reduces the reliance on expensive cloud subscriptions and enhances data privacy, as sensitive information no longer needs to leave the device. Companies that control the ecosystem—combining custom silicon with a seamless operating system—are best positioned to capture this value, creating a locked-in user base that benefits from localized, low-latency intelligence.

Synthesis of Risk and Opportunity

Despite the growth potential, the AI sector in 2026 faces significant headwinds. Regulatory frameworks across the EU and North America have tightened, focusing on algorithmic transparency and copyright compensation. Furthermore, the "energy wall" remains a systemic risk; the ability of the power grid to support the exponential growth of data centers could lead to volatility in stock prices for those unable to innovate in green energy or efficiency.

In summary, the investment thesis for AI has moved from a broad bet on technology to a surgical focus on infrastructure autonomy, agentic utility, and edge deployment. The winners of this era will be those who can bridge the gap between theoretical intelligence and practical, scalable, and energy-efficient application.
